Description
Frank Herbert’s epic masterpiece–a triumph of the imagination and the bestselling science fiction novel of all time.
Set on the desert planet Arrakis, Dune is the story of Paul Atreides–who would become known as Muad’Dib–and of a great family’s ambition to bring to fruition humankind’s most ancient and unattainable dream.

About the Author
Frank Herbert is the bestselling author of the Dune saga. He was born in Tacoma, Washington, and educated at the University of Washington, Seattle. He worked a wide variety of jobs–including TV cameraman, radio commentator, oyster diver, jungle survival instructor, lay analyst, creative writing teacher, reporter and editor of several West Coast newspapers–before becoming a full-time writer.
